Sorry, Grumpy Cat—Study finds dogs are brainier than cats

 

Quote

There’s a new twist to the perennial argument about which is smarter, cats or dogs.

It has to do with their brains, specifically the number of neurons in their cerebral cortex: the “little gray cells” associated with thinking, planning and complex behavior —all considered hallmarks of intelligence.

The first study to actually count the number of cortical neurons in the brains of a number of carnivores, including cats and dogs, has found that dogs possess significantly more of them than cats.

    • JetBrains launches Rider 2026.2 EAP 5, bringing several AI improvements by David Uzondu JetBrains has released the fifth EAP version of Rider 2026.2, bringing a faster startup flow with the new non-modal startup screen and quality-check hooks for Claude Code and Codex. In the latest EAP release, Rider now has newly bundled "quality-check" hooks that run background tests on code edits before the external agent proceeds. For example, after Claude Code rewrites a class, Rider immediately triggers a PostToolUse hook that analyzes the code for syntax errors and formatting warnings. It then passes those findings back to the model as feedback, allowing the agent to fix its own output before finalizing the task. If Rider detects compilation errors, the IDE prevents the agent from treating the task as complete, while minor formatting warnings simply help guide the model toward better output. The "Explain with AI" feature can now tackle tricky build errors directly from the console, helping .NET developers who frequently wrestle with multi-targeting failures and MSBuild errors. JetBrains introduced Explain with AI back in the 2024.1 release cycle. With this feature, instead of forcing developers to copy long diagnostics into a separate chat window, Rider now lets you trigger these explanations directly from the error source. In similar EAP news, JetBrains recently opened the first EAP for IntelliJ IDEA 2026.2, with features that appeal to both those who are into AI-assisted coding and those who prefer "classic" manual development. For manual developers, the release adds revamped dependency completion for Maven and Gradle build scripts, which pulls data directly from the local cache to suggest relevant versions. It also brings the Spring Debugger update, displaying security indicators next to endpoints to visualize secured routes during runtime. In addition to database migration tools for Flyway and Liquibase, this build introduces a Hibernate debugger that shows the exact SQL or HQL queries that the framework plans to execute, letting developers jump directly to the Java code that triggered them.

    • WhatsApp slams Isreali firm, NSO Group, for trying to spy on its users by David Uzondu WhatsApp has come out accusing Israeli cyber-intelligence firm, NSO Group, of deploying a fresh wave of highly targeted "spear phishing" attacks against users, which its security teams successfully thwarted. The Israeli firm, according to WhatsApp, ran this operation like its usual one-click phishing campaigns, trying to get people to click malicious links that lead them to external sites. To coordinate the campaign, the spyware vendor created fake test accounts and groups on the messaging app. WhatsApp said it is sharing the specific malicious domains, ikhwancast[.]com, ghazacast[.]com, and fr24cast[.]com, because potential victims need this data to check if they were targeted across other messaging systems or email platforms. The NSO Group is infamous for creating and selling Pegasus, a military-grade commercial spyware capable of silently compromising smartphones simply by sending a message or placing a missed call via apps like WhatsApp or iMessage. Users do not even have to interact with the incoming notification before the infection takes hold. Once Pegasus manages to break in, the spyware harvests private data, letting operators read private messages, emails, photos, and documents. It also tracks precise GPS locations, records keystrokes, activates the device's camera, and monitors live microphone audio. Independent investigations by cybersecurity watchdogs like The Citizen Lab and human rights organizations like Amnesty International have proven that governments use this software to track humanitarian workers, journalists, diplomats, and political dissidents. These findings directly contradict NSO Group claims that clients use the technology to spy on criminals and terrorists only. In late 2021, the U.S. Department of Commerce added the firm to its Entity List, effectively banning the vendor from buying hardware and software from American tech companies. WhatsApp said in its blog post that the spyware vendor violated a permanent court injunction with this new spear-phishing campaign. This injunction, which took effect in 2025, strictly prohibited NSO Group from targeting WhatsApp and its users. The platform is now asking a federal court to hold the firm in contempt.
